India is set to face arch-rivals Pakistan in their opening match of the U19 Asia Cup on Saturday at the Dubai International Cricket Stadium. The tournament promises high-octane action as India aims to secure their ninth U19 Asia Cup title under the leadership of skipper Mohammed Amaan.

India’s Squad and Notable Names
India’s squad boasts a mix of talent and promising youngsters, including 13-year-old Vaibhav Suryavanshi. The Rajasthan Royals picked up Suryavanshi for INR 1.1 crore during the IPL mega auction in Jeddah, making him the youngest player ever to be signed in an IPL auction.
India is placed in Group A alongside Pakistan, Japan, and the UAE. Defending champions Bangladesh are in Group B with Sri Lanka, Afghanistan, and Nepal.
Tournament Format and Key Dates
The 50-over tournament features two groups, with the top two teams from each group advancing to the semifinals.
Semifinals: December 6
Final: December 8, to be held at the Dubai International Cricket Stadium

India and Pakistan Squads
India U19 Squad:
Ayush Mhatre, Vaibhav Suryavanshi, C Andre Siddarth, Mohammed Amaan (C), Kiran Chormale, Pranav Pant, Harvansh Singh Pangalia (WK), Anurag Kawde (WK), Hardik Raj, Md. Enaan, KP Karthikeya, Samarth Nagaraj, Yudhajit Guha, Chetan Sharma, Nikhil Kumar
Pakistan U19 Squad:
Saad Baig (C/WK), Mohammad Ahmed, Haroon Arshad, Tayyab Arif, Mohammad Huzefa, Naveed Ahmed Khan, Hassan Khan, Shahzaib Khan, Usman Khan, Faham-ul-Haq, Ali Raza, Mohammad Riazullah, Abdul Subhan, Farhan Yousuf, Umar Zaib
